Venice, the city of canals, is one of the world's most enchanting and romantic destinations. With its rich history, breathtaking architecture, and unique traditions, Venice is a treasure trove waiting to be explored.
The Rich History of Venice
Venice was founded in the 5th century and grew to become a powerful city-state. It was an important center for commerce, art, and culture during the Middle Ages and the Renaissance. Walking through Venice feels like stepping back in time, with its narrow streets, ancient buildings, and historic landmarks.
The Iconic Canals and Gondolas
The canals are the defining feature of Venice, with the Grand Canal being the most famous. Gondolas have been used as the primary mode of transport for centuries and offer a unique way to explore the city. A gondola ride through the winding canals provides a serene and romantic experience that is quintessentially Venetian.
Must-Visit Squares and Bridges
Piazza San Marco is the heart of Venice, home to the stunning St. Mark’s Basilica and the imposing Doge’s Palace. The Rialto Bridge, the oldest and most iconic bridge across the Grand Canal, offers a spectacular view of the waterway and the bustling market below.
Venetian Festivals
Venetian festivals are vibrant and colorful, with the Venice Carnival being the most famous. Known for its elaborate masks and grand balls, the Carnival is a celebration of Venetian culture and tradition that attracts visitors from around the world.
